在当今这个大数据时代,数据已经成为企业和社会发展的重要资源。随着大数据技术的不断成熟和应用,与之相关的职业岗位也日益受到重视。本文将详细介绍数据分析师、数据科学家、数据工程师等热门岗位,帮助读者了解这些职业的特点、职责以及所需技能。
数据分析师
职业概述
数据分析师是负责收集、整理、分析、解释数据,并为企业提供决策支持的专业人员。他们通常使用数据分析工具和技术,对大量数据进行挖掘,以发现数据背后的规律和趋势。
职责
- 数据收集与整理:从各种数据源收集数据,并进行清洗、整理,确保数据的准确性和完整性。
- 数据分析:运用统计学、数据挖掘等方法对数据进行处理和分析,挖掘数据背后的价值。
- 数据可视化:将分析结果以图表、报表等形式呈现,便于决策者理解。
- 业务支持:根据分析结果,为企业提供决策支持,优化业务流程。
技能要求
- 统计学知识:熟悉统计学原理和方法,能够运用统计工具进行数据分析。
- 数据分析工具:熟练掌握Excel、Python、R等数据分析工具。
- 业务理解:具备一定的业务知识,能够将数据分析结果与业务实际相结合。
数据科学家
职业概述
数据科学家是运用统计学、机器学习、深度学习等技术,从海量数据中提取有价值信息,为企业提供创新解决方案的专业人员。
职责
- 数据挖掘:运用机器学习、深度学习等技术,从海量数据中挖掘有价值的信息。
- 算法开发:设计、开发、优化数据挖掘算法,提高数据分析的准确性和效率。
- 模型评估:评估模型性能,优化模型参数,提高模型预测能力。
- 业务应用:将数据挖掘结果应用于实际业务场景,为企业创造价值。
技能要求
- 数学与统计学:具备扎实的数学和统计学基础,熟悉概率论、线性代数、统计学等知识。
- 编程能力:熟练掌握Python、R等编程语言,熟悉机器学习、深度学习框架。
- 业务理解:具备一定的业务知识,能够将数据挖掘结果与业务实际相结合。
数据工程师
职业概述
数据工程师负责构建和维护数据平台,确保数据质量和稳定性,为数据分析师和数据科学家提供数据支持。
职责
- 数据平台搭建:设计、搭建、维护数据平台,确保数据质量和稳定性。
- 数据处理:对数据进行清洗、转换、存储等操作,为数据分析提供高质量的数据。
- 数据安全:确保数据安全,防止数据泄露和滥用。
- 性能优化:优化数据平台性能,提高数据处理效率。
技能要求
- 编程能力:熟练掌握Python、Java等编程语言,熟悉Hadoop、Spark等大数据处理框架。
- 数据库知识:熟悉MySQL、Oracle等关系型数据库,以及Hive、MongoDB等NoSQL数据库。
- 系统架构:具备一定的系统架构知识,能够设计高性能、可扩展的数据平台。
在当前的大数据时代,数据分析师、数据科学家、数据工程师等职业具有广阔的发展前景。掌握相关技能,不断提升自身能力,将有助于在职场中脱颖而出。
